    Local Coffee Club is a subscription service that provides freshly roasted coffee from independent roasters in your local area or anywhere in the UK. The service comes with an environmentally friendly box for your letterbox and recyclable bags. You can select between cafetiere, filter and espresso ground beans. You can choose to subscribe weekly, monthly, or fortnightly. Each bag contains a QR code which links to a comprehensive brewing guide as well as tasting notes and information of the origin.

    This coffee comes from the Pereira region of Risaralda in Colombia. It is medium-bodied, full-flavored, and rich in flavor with notes of orange and chocolate. It is decaffeinated through the natural method. This uses a byproduct of sugarcane fermentation in order to remove caffeine from beans without damaging the beans.
